Your journey begins with a flight or train from Mumbai to Cochin, followed by a picturesque drive to Munnar, Kerala's famous hill station. Explore sprawling tea estates, waterfalls, and breathtaking viewpoints before heading to Thekkady, home to the renowned Periyar Wildlife Sanctuary. Continue your adventure with a relaxing stay in Alleppey, where the mesmerizing backwaters and traditional houseboats create memories that last a lifetime.

Q1. What is the best time to visit Kerala?
Ans. Everything is changed with the time lets find the best time according to the latest conditions. The best time is October to March with pleasant weather. Monsoon (June–September) is ideal for Ayurvedic treatments and lush greenery.
Q2. Does Kerala receive heavy rainfall?
Ans. Yes, especially during monsoon (June-August), making it very scenic but humid.
Q3. What should I pack for Kerala?
Ans. Light cotton clothes Sunscreen & sunglasses Comfortable footwear Umbrella/raincoat (monsoon)
Q4. Is it safe to travel in Kerala?
Ans. Yes, Kerala is considered one of the safest tourist destinations in India.

Q6. How can I reach Kerala in 2026?
Ans. Air: Airports in Kochi, Trivandrum, and Calicut Rail: Well-connected railway network Road: Smooth highways and scenic drives
